George Russell saw his seat at Mercedes become a reality last week. He will drive next year alongside Lewis Hamilton and will get the chance to fight for the world championship with Hamilton and Max Verstappen. At least that is what Mercedes told the young Briton.

According to Russell he and Hamilton will be treated as equals next year. He said this during today's press conference before the weekend in Monza. MotorsportWeek quotes the Brit.

"We will be equals. That has been made clear to me. Of course I have high hopes, but I know it won't be easy next to Lewis - he's a seven-time champion! I see my partnership with Mercedes as something for the long term. I see next year as a great opportunity to learn. We are at different stages of our careers, but the aim is to drive the team forward together."

Mercedes wants to avoid a repeat of Rosberg

Because if there's anything right now that Mercedes isn't waiting for, that's it. A repeat of moves. As Russell also knows. "Mercedes has had the experience of a tricky dynamic (between Rosberg and Hamilton). They've made it clear they don't want that anymore. I don't want that either. We don't know who will have the best car next year. So the most important thing is working together to make sure we are strong in 2022. I have a lot of respect for Lewis in that, because I'm a lot younger and was watching him when I was still driving karts."

In any case, it looks like Verstappen will have a formidable rival for next year. Whether Russell will actually be treated equally, something Valtteri Bottas can only dream of, remains to be seen.
